Stan guessed on all 10 questions of a multiple-choice quiz. Each question has 4 answer choices. What is the probability that he
algol13

ANSWER
0.756

EXPLANATION

Let x represent number of correct answers.

We can find

   P(x = 0 \text{ or } x = 1)

which leads us to

   P(x\ge 2) = 1 - P(x = 0\text{ or }x = 1)

which uses the compliment of P(x = 0\text{ or }x = 1) to find the probability of getting at least 2 questions correct.

Note that since P(x=0) and P(x=1) are mutually exclusive, we have

   P(x = 0\text{ or }x = 1) = P(x=0) + P(x=1)

Then P(x=0) = 3^{10}/4^{10} = (3/4)^{10} as we have 3^{10} to answer the questions incorrectly divided by the total 4^{10} to answer the questions.

Exactly 1 answer correct: P(x=1) = {}_{10}C_1 \cdot(3/4)^9(1/4)^1

Therefore

   \begin{aligned}
P(x \ge 2) &= 1 - P(x = 0\text{ or }x =1) \\
&=1 - \big[P(x=0) + P(x=1)\big] \\
&=1 - \left[ (3/4)^{10} + {}_{10}C_1 \cdot (3/4)^9(1/4)^1 \right] \\
&\approx 0.756
\end{aligned}

Write the equation of a line that passes through point (2,3) and (0,9).
11Alexandr11 [23.1K]

Slope-intercept form:

y = mx + b        

"m" is the slope, "b" is the y-intercept (the y value when x = 0) or (0,y)


To find "m", you can use the slope formula and plug in the two points:

(2,3) = (x₁ , y₁)

(0,9) = (x₂ , y₂)


m=\frac{y_{2}-y_{1}}{x_{2}-x_{1}}

m=\frac{9-3}{0-2}

m=\frac{6}{-2}

m = -3


y = -3x + b

To find "b", you can plug in one of the points into the equation (however they already gave you the y-intercept (0,9) or 9)


(2,3)

y = -3x + b

3 = -3(2) + b

3 = -6 + b

9 = b


y = -3x + 9
